Lactose intolerance is a common condition where the body is unable to digest lactose, a sugar found in milk and dairy products. It occurs when the small intestine does not produce enough lactase, an enzyme that breaks down lactose.
Causes of Lactose Intolerance
The most common cause of lactose intolerance is aging. As people get older, their body produces less lactase, leading to reduced ability to digest lactose. Other causes include digestive conditions such as Crohn’s disease, having surgery on the intestines, or taking certain medications.
Symptoms of Lactose Intolerance
The symptoms of lactose intolerance can vary from person to person but common ones include:
- Gas and bloating
- Nausea and diarrhea
- Abdominal cramps and pain
Treatment for Lactose Intolerance
The main treatment for lactose intolerance is to limit or avoid dairy products that contain lactose. There are also several over-the-counter supplements available that can help break down lactose, such as Lactaid. Drinking lactose-free milk or taking a liquid lactase replacement can also be helpful.
Prevention and Management
To manage lactose intolerance, it’s recommended to:
- Eat small amounts of dairy products to test tolerance
- Choose lactose-free alternatives when available
- Take supplements as advised by a healthcare professional
- Consult with a doctor or registered dietitian for personalized advice on managing lactose intolerance.
